Transcranial Magnetic Stimulation (TMS) is a non-invasive procedure that uses magnetic fields to stimulate nerve cells in the brain to improve symptoms of depression. It is typically used when other depression treatments haven’t been effective. TMS is performed in a doctor’s office and does not require anesthesia or sedation. During the procedure, an electromagnetic coil is placed against the scalp near the forehead. The electromagnet delivers a magnetic pulse that stimulates nerve cells in the region of the brain involved in mood control and depression.
Ketamine IV therapy, on the other hand, is a treatment that involves the administration of ketamine, a medication that has been used for decades as an anesthetic, through an intravenous (IV) infusion. In recent years, ketamine has gained attention for its rapid and robust antidepressant effects. Ketamine IV therapy is typically used for individuals who have not responded to traditional antidepressant medications. The treatment is administered in a controlled medical setting, and patients are monitored closely throughout the infusion to ensure safety and effectiveness.
The Science Behind Brain Healing
The brain is a complex organ that is responsible for controlling our thoughts, emotions, and behaviors. When it comes to healing the brain, there are several key processes at play. One of the most important processes involved in brain healing is neuroplasticity, which refers to the brain’s ability to reorganize itself by forming new neural connections. This process is essential for learning and memory, as well as for recovering from brain injuries and illnesses.
Another important aspect of brain healing is neurogenesis, which is the process of generating new neurons in the brain. Neurogenesis occurs primarily in the hippocampus, a region of the brain that is involved in memory and emotion regulation. This process is crucial for maintaining cognitive function and emotional well-being. Additionally, dendritic spine density, which refers to the number and distribution of dendritic spines on neurons, plays a key role in brain healing. Dendritic spines are small protrusions on the dendrites of neurons that play a critical role in synaptic transmission and plasticity.
The Role of Neurogenesis in TMS and Ketamine IV Therapy
Both TMS and ketamine IV therapy have been shown to have a positive impact on neurogenesis in the brain. Studies have demonstrated that TMS can increase neurogenesis in the hippocampus, which may contribute to its antidepressant effects. By stimulating neural activity in this region of the brain, TMS may promote the generation of new neurons, leading to improved mood and cognitive function.
Similarly, ketamine has been found to promote neurogenesis in the hippocampus. Research has shown that ketamine can increase the proliferation of neural stem cells and promote the survival and integration of new neurons in this brain region. These effects may contribute to ketamine’s rapid antidepressant effects and its ability to improve cognitive function.
Dendritic Spine Density and its Impact on Mental Health
Dendritic spine density plays a crucial role in mental health, as it is closely linked to synaptic plasticity and neural communication. Changes in dendritic spine density have been implicated in various psychiatric disorders, including depression, anxiety, and schizophrenia. Studies have shown that individuals with depression often have reduced dendritic spine density in certain brain regions, which may contribute to the symptoms of the disorder.
Both TMS and ketamine IV therapy have been found to impact dendritic spine density in the brain. TMS has been shown to increase dendritic spine density in animal models, particularly in the prefrontal cortex, a brain region involved in mood regulation and decision-making. This increase in dendritic spine density may contribute to the antidepressant effects of TMS by enhancing synaptic connectivity and neural communication.
Similarly, ketamine has been found to rapidly increase dendritic spine density in the prefrontal cortex. This effect may be one of the mechanisms underlying ketamine’s rapid antidepressant effects, as it can lead to enhanced synaptic plasticity and improved neural communication in this critical brain region.
Exploring the Benefits of TMS and Ketamine IV Therapy
TMS and ketamine IV therapy offer a range of benefits for individuals struggling with treatment-resistant depression and other psychiatric disorders. TMS has been shown to be effective in reducing symptoms of depression and improving overall mood. It is also well-tolerated and does not have the systemic side effects associated with many traditional antidepressant medications.
Ketamine IV therapy has gained attention for its rapid antidepressant effects, with many individuals experiencing significant improvements in mood within hours of receiving treatment. Ketamine has also been found to be effective for individuals who have not responded to other antidepressant medications, making it a valuable option for those with treatment-resistant depression.
In addition to their antidepressant effects, both TMS and ketamine IV therapy have been found to improve cognitive function and overall brain health. These treatments may also have potential benefits for other psychiatric disorders, such as anxiety, post-traumatic stress disorder (PTSD), and obsessive-compulsive disorder (OCD).

Looking Towards the Future: The Potential of TMS and Ketamine IV Therapy
As research into TMS and ketamine IV therapy continues to advance, there is growing excitement about the potential of these treatments to revolutionize mental health care. Ongoing studies are exploring the use of TMS for a range of psychiatric disorders beyond depression, including anxiety disorders, bipolar disorder, and schizophrenia.
Similarly, research into ketamine IV therapy is uncovering new insights into its mechanisms of action and potential applications. There is increasing interest in exploring the use of ketamine for conditions such as PTSD, chronic pain, and substance use disorders.
In addition to expanding the use of these treatments for psychiatric disorders, there is also interest in optimizing treatment protocols to enhance their effectiveness and accessibility. This includes exploring different stimulation parameters for TMS and refining infusion protocols for ketamine IV therapy.
Overall, the future looks promising for TMS and ketamine IV therapy as innovative treatments for mental health disorders. With ongoing research and clinical advancements, these treatments have the potential to offer new hope for individuals who have not found relief from traditional medications or therapies.

What is TMS therapy?
TMS (Transcranial Magnetic Stimulation) therapy is a non-invasive procedure that uses magnetic fields to stimulate nerve cells in the brain to improve symptoms of depression and anxiety.
How does TMS therapy work?
During a TMS session, an electromagnetic coil is placed against the patient’s scalp near the forehead. The coil delivers repetitive magnetic pulses that stimulate the nerve cells in the brain, particularly those involved in mood regulation.
What is Ketamine IV therapy?
Ketamine IV therapy is a treatment that involves the administration of ketamine, a medication traditionally used for anesthesia, through an intravenous (IV) infusion. It has been found to be effective in treating depression, anxiety, and certain chronic pain conditions.
How does Ketamine IV therapy work?
Ketamine IV therapy works by targeting and modulating certain neurotransmitters in the brain, such as glutamate and GABA, which are believed to play a role in mood regulation. The infusion of ketamine can lead to rapid and significant improvements in symptoms for some patients.
